Registered Veterinary Nurse (RVN) - Fixed Term Opportunities

My client is currently offering two fixed-term Registered Veterinary Nurse (RVN) positions at its Epping Hospital. These roles are available on a 12-month maternity cover basis and involve full-time hours of 40 per week, with salaries starting from Β£29,000 per annum depending on experience.

These positions have been created to support the hospital during the temporary absence of two Lead Nurses. As such, they provide an excellent opportunity for experienced RVNs to step into roles with increased responsibility, gaining valuable exposure to leadership within a well-established and progressive veterinary environment.

This is a busy hospital in Epping alongside several branch practices. The hospital holds ISFM Silver Cat Friendly accreditation and is equipped with advanced facilities including CT and MRI imaging, laparoscopy, endoscopy (both rigid and flexible), ultrasonography, dental x-ray, and a fully equipped in-house laboratory. The clinical team includes a number of highly experienced professionals, including certificate holders, all working within a supportive and collaborative environment that prioritises high standards of patient care and professional development.

The successful candidates will be confident and capable RVNs who can quickly integrate into the team and take on additional responsibilities. During the maternity cover period, they will support the wider hospital team in the absence of Lead Nurses and may take ownership of specific clinical or operational areas such as stock management, laboratory processes, dentistry, or other focus areas aligned with their experience. The role also involves mentoring student nurses, working closely with senior leadership, and contributing to the overall efficiency and standards of the nursing team.

Working patterns include a mixture of early, late, and occasional twilight shifts, along with participation in a 1 in 6 weekend rota at the hospital, with time off in lieu provided. There is no out-of-hours requirement, as a dedicated night team is in place.

Applicants must be RCVS-registered Veterinary Nurses. While candidates with at least one year of post-qualification experience are preferred, strong applicants with less experience will also be considered. Previous experience as a clinical coach or in a supervisory capacity would be advantageous. The ideal candidate will be proactive, team-oriented, and possess strong communication skills, with an interest in gaining leadership experience without committing to a formal Lead Nurse position.

The role offers strong support for professional development, including funded external CPD, access toin-house CPD programmes, and opportunities to gain experience in hospital-level nursing and specialist services. Although these are fixed-term roles, there may be potential for permanent opportunities in the future.

Flexible working arrangements are available, with options including four 10-hour days or five 8-hour days per week.

In addition to a competitive salary, the positions offer a comprehensive benefits package. This includes five weeks' annual leave plus bank holidays and an additional birthday leave day, payment of RCVS and VDS fees, funded CPD with allocated days, a contributory pension scheme, life assurance, enhanced sickness and family leave policies, and access to salary sacrifice schemes such as electric car leasing and cycle to work. Employees also benefit from staff discounts, a benefits hub, and a range of wellbeing support services, including an Employee Assistance Programme, eyecare vouchers, and annual flu vaccinations.
